This is the execution-capable Morpho workflow skill.
It is the Morpho-side counterpart to the EVK skill. It is still more conservative than the EVK path, but it now supports a real end-to-end flow for compatible requests: resolve the requested collateral and borrow assets, check feed readiness, execute funding when available, deploy the oracle adapter, deploy the Morpho market, and verify the result.
This published skill carries its own local runtime and bundled planning artifacts under scripts/lib/ and data/part2/ rather than assuming a separate repo checkout is available at execution time.
It should script as much of the Morpho path as the code can honestly support: feed readiness classification, executable funding, communal proxy deployment when needed, propagation rechecks, adapter deployment, market deployment, verification, resumable artifacts, and a generated rollback-plan.json for every orchestrated run.
When the supported path is available and the user explicitly asks for it, this variant can send real transactions and should be treated as a guarded execution skill rather than a planning-only helper.

Check agent-decision.json first after wrapper runs. It is the small model-friendly status object with safeStatus, nextCommand, mustNotDo, and successClaimAllowed.
Check rollback-plan.json before sending any further dependent transactions. It records whether the run stayed local-only or already created forward-only onchain state.

agentic-lending-morpho explain-next --run-dir --format json agentic-lending-morpho verify-feed-to-market-handoff --run-dir --format json Treat bundled data/part2/feed-status.json and data/part2/market-registry.json as packaged snapshots. They are valid local inputs for fallback planning paths, but live RPC-backed checks still take precedence whenever the request needs a current on-chain claim.
Do not infer success from narrative text. Use exact wrapper fields and artifacts. Read references/summary-contract.md for the full contract.
